In fact, a large percentage of U.S. railroads built in the nineteenth century were financed by sales of foreign bonds in Britain.
<u>Explanation:</u>
Foreign bonds are the traditional assets and involved in international bond market. These are traded in foreign countries and represented in currency of the same country.
The United States railroad construction initiated remarkable development during 19th century in U.S. economic and financial factors. The railroad projects were financed with the help of private capital markets, while 2/3rd of U.S. railroad securities was clutched by
British investors during World War-I and London was highlighted as major foreign listing venue for U.S. railroads. Analysis predicts that with 292 ordinary equity or foreign bond listings includes 193 U.S. railroads within 3 European exchanges.

Developmental psychology is the study of how and why the personality of a person changes over time. Every aspect of how the environment changes the personality to the effects it has on personality is studies in developmental psychology.
Three dimensions of psychology are studied here: physical development of the body, cognitive development of the mind, and socioemotional development.

As salt was worth its weight in gold, and gold was so abundant in the kingdom, Ghana achieved much of its wealth through trade with the Arabs. Islamic merchants traveled over two months through the desert to reach Ghana and "do business." They were taxed for both what they brought in and what they took out.
